What is a self-luminous pest trap?

A self-luminous pest trap uses glow-in-the-dark photoluminescent material to create a visible attraction point without electricity, batteries, or chemical sprays. After absorbing ambient light, the material releases a soft glow that can help guide insects toward an adhesive capture area.

Why photoluminescent materials matter

Photoluminescent materials are useful because they store light and release it gradually. In a pest trap, that means the product can keep a visual signal without wiring or active power.
